Shamima Haque is a scholar working on Strategy and Management, Soil Science and Sociology and Political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Shamima Haque has authored 54 papers receiving a total of 714 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 19 papers in Strategy and Management, 19 papers in Soil Science and 10 papers in Sociology and Political Science. Recurrent topics in Shamima Haque’s work include Corporate Social Responsibility Reporting (16 papers), Agricultural Science and Fertilization (9 papers) and Soil erosion and sediment transport (9 papers). Shamima Haque is often cited by papers focused on Corporate Social Responsibility Reporting (16 papers), Agricultural Science and Fertilization (9 papers) and Soil erosion and sediment transport (9 papers). Shamima Haque collaborates with scholars based in Bangladesh, Australia and United Kingdom. Shamima Haque's co-authors include Craig Deegan, Muhammad Azizul Islam, Khan Towhid Osman, Zhongtian Li, Robert Inglis, Steven Dellaportas, Mark E. Swanson, Mohammed Jashimuddin, Muhammad Shafiq and Robin W. Roberts and has published in prestigious journals such as Ecological Indicators, Environmental Monitoring and Assessment and Accounting Auditing & Accountability Journal.
